Primary referenceMechanistic implications from structures of yeast alcohol dehydrogenase complexed with coenzyme and an alcohol., Plapp BV, Charlier HA Jr, Ramaswamy S, Arch Biochem Biophys. 2015 Dec 29;591:35-42. doi: 10.1016/j.abb.2015.12.009. PMID:26743849
